    So where do you use your yak?

    Just interested to hear the types of places folks use their yaks. I got mine mostly for fishing small lakes and rivers in central KY. Had it out on Corinth, Beaver Lake, Elk Horn, and Licking River. I have also used it in salt ponds in Rhode Island, Buzzards Bay in Cape Cod, and even a few beach areas on the Atlantic around Rhode Island (calm days!).

    Mostly bass fish (LM and SM) from the yak. In the salt, I've caught bluefish, stripers, Sea Bass, scup, and fluke.

    I mostly fish Drakes creek around Bowling Green.Have fished Elkhorn.Barren river & lake,Nolin,Shanty Hollow.I've fished in Mi with it.I fish mostly for LM & SM but have caught carp,bluegills,rockbass & a 19inch cat fish on a spinner bait from Elkhorn.White,yellow,hybird bass.This is my 2nd yr doing it from a yak & its a blast.It opened up a lot of spots that boats never will go.I think i've had more fun in my yak if i don't count chasing down the jumps at 60mph on Nolin.Man i need too get on those jumps with my yak.I plan on getting a Hobbie for the lakes because i have some freinds who catch strippers from theirs.
